노근리사건 민간인 희생자 및 유가족 복지지원을 위한 기반모색 연구
이경준 한국사회복지연구원 2014 복지사회 Vol.1 No.1
본고는 한국전쟁 당시 미군에 의한 민간인 희생을 가져온 노근리사건에 대한 진상규명 및 배상 요구 등의 활동상을 정리하고, 그의 시대적 성격과 의의를 파악함으로써 피해자 및 그 유족에 대한 복지적 지원방안 마련의 기초를 제공하는 것을 목적으로 한다. 이에 따른 복지적 기반조성의 방안으로서 노근리사건특별법상 희생자 및 유가족 등에 대한 생활지원관련 근거 마련, 영동군 및 충청북도 자치조례 제정 및 정리를 통한 지자체 수준에서의 지원근거 마련, 생존당사자들의 고령화에 따른 양로지원 측면에서의 시설 설치 및 운영, 희생자 및 유가족을 위한 의료정책적 지원, 신체적, 정신적, 사회심리적 지원인프라 구축, 노근리 평화공원의 컨텐츠 내실화 및 행정지원체계 정비, 중앙정부 내지 지자체 수준에서의 추념일 지정, 노근리사건 관련 연구 활성화 등을 제안하였다. This study arranges contents on activity development of truth ascertainment and claim for compensation about the "Nogunri Incident" at the time of the Korean War and has the purpose to seek the foundation of ways of rational welfare support for the victims and bereaved families by grasping characteristics and meanings of the time. As basic ways according to them, preparation of clauses related with living support for the victims and bereaved families under the Special Act on the Nogunri Incident, preparation of support foundation through the enactment or arrangement of autonomy ordinances of Yeongdong-gun and Chungcheongbuk-do, facility installation and preparation of operation plans in the level of support in caring for the aged people in accordance with aging of the survivors. preparation of medical policies in physical, psychological, and psychosocial aspects, support of content substantiality in operating Nogunri Pyeonghwa [peace] Park and reorganization of the administration system, enactment of the memorial day in the level of the central government or the local government unit, recovery of the tarnished reputation of the victims, and vitalization in an academic level in aspect of human right were proposed.
이경준,홍봉기 한국산림과학회 2005 한국산림과학회지 Vol.94 No.2
The objectives of this study were to identify the period of initiation of floral primordia in black locust (Robinia pseudoacacia L.) and subsequent development of floral buds until following spring. Four mature trees of black locust located in Suwon, Korea were selected. Bud samples were collected from the current-year shoots, starting from mid June to July every week, from August to October and from February to April every month. The buds were fixed in FAA solution, dehydrated, and imbedded in paraffin for microscopic observation. Buds collected on June 16, and 23, 1997, contained primitive primordia that might be interpreted as early floral primordia. By June 30, a bud showed a positive indication of inflorescence primordium with a well-formed shoot apex. All the inflorescence primordia observed throughout the collection periods were always associated with unique hairy appendages around the primordium and enclosed within a sclerenchymatous chamber. By July 7 and 15, a floral apex had early bud scales. By July 22, primitive inflorescence developed into visible arrangement of individual floral primordial By July 29, the inflorescence developed into whirl arrangement of individual floral primordia in a transverse section, but showed little further development until October 15. The inflorescence primordia seemed to over-winter at this stage. Buds collected from February 15 and March 24 the following year also showed no further development of inflorescence primordia. By April 7 the inflorescence started to show further development with elongated axis. At this time individual flowers were easily recognized.
DS-CDMA/DPSK 셀룰라 이동통신 시스템에서 간섭 제거기와 RAKE 수신기에 의한 성능 개선
이경준,오창헌,조성준,채수환 대한전자공학회 1996 전자공학회논문지-A Vol.33 No.4
In this paper, we analyzed the performance improvement of the DS-CDMA/dPSK cellular mobile communication system with CCI canceller and RAKE receiver techniques in mobile radio channel which is characterized by AWGN, Multi-user interference (mUI) and frequency-selective rayleigh fading. System capacity i.e., number of user per cell has been derived and the evaluated results are shown in figuraes as a function of PN code sequence length, number of RAKE receiver tap, BER and E$_{b}$/N$_{o}$. The voice activity factor is assumed to be 3/8 the number of sectors in a cell 3 and MUI is modeled as gaussian process. From the results, the capacity of the DS-CDMA/DPSK cellular mobile communication system is improved by adopting CCI canceller. When we adopt the RAKE receiver to mitigate the multipath fading, the error performance is improved and the amount of improvement is proportional ot the number of taps L in the case that each tap contains a signal component and the better of improvement can be obtained, the smaller of the SNR difference in each tap. The system capacity is more increased when the CCI canceller and the RAKE receiver is used in cascade.
창공91의 비행시험을 통한 속도 및 고도 보정에 관한 연구
黃明信,李晶模,李璟埈 한국항공대학교 1992 論文集 Vol.30 No.-
본 연구는 창공91 항공기의 비행시험을 수행하기 위하여 기본이되는 항공기의 고도계와 속도계를 보정하는 방법에 대해 기술하였으며, 실제 비행시험을 통한 결과를 이용하여 항공기의 계기를 보정하는 방법을 나타내었다. 속도계와 고도계를 보정하기 위하여 수행되는 비행시험에는 여러가지 방법이 있지만, 본 연구에서는 일반적으로 경항공기를 제작하여 판매하는 항공기 제작사에서 운용되는 방법인 tower flyby 방법과 system to system방법을 사용하였다. 이 방법은 pitot head에 오차가 없음을 가정한 방법이다. 비행시험을 통해 실제 측정된 자료들은 항공기 계기 보정에 적절함을 알 수 있었다. A study on the airspeed and altimeter calibration of Chang-Gong 91 was conducted by the flight test. Airspeed calibration are conducted using the altimeter method(tower flyby). This method assumes that all the airspeed position error is caused by the static system and that there is no error in the pitot head. For that reason, this method is used mainly in the small aircraft manufacture company. We have been also conducted the ‘system to system’ method using the swivel head airspeed booms. Flight test data is corrected for instrument error and position error, and the resulting data was satisfied.
